The Territory of Heard Island and McDonald Islands (HIMI) is an Australian external territory comprising a volcanic group of mostly barren Antarctic islands, about two-thirds of the way from Madagascar to Antarctica.The group''s overall size is 372 km 2 (144 sq mi) in area and it has 101.9 km (63 mi) of coastline. The UK union jack flag is considered the only previous flag to have been used on the Heard and McDonald Islands. It was first hoisted on the island in 1910. The HIMI complex is part of the Kerguelen Plateau, which is a large submerged continental plateau that extends more than 2,000 km, with only a few emergent volcanic islands. Heard Island and McDonald Island are the two largest islands with the only two active volcanoes in Australia.

Heard and McDonald Islands

A few kilometers offshore are the Shag Islands. About 80 percent of Heard is glaciated, with ice up to 495 ft (150 m) deep. Ice cliffs make up much of the coast, adding to the island''s inaccessibility. The McDonald Island group is made up of one volcanic peak and several smaller rocky islets (Flat Island, Meyer Rock).

Heard Island is a major research site along the Antarctic Environmental Gradient (AEG). The AEG spans 30 degrees of latitude and includes a range of macro-climatic zones from cool temperate islands to the frigid and arid Antarctic continent. Mawson Peak on Heard Island is the highest Australian mountain (at 2,745 meters, it is taller than Mt. Kosciuszko in Australia proper), and one of only two active volcanoes located in Australian territory, the other being McDonald Island; in 1992, McDonald Island broke its dormancy and began erupting; it has erupted several times since, most recently in 2005

Heard Island is 43 km long and 21 km wide. McDonald Islands are a group of uninhabited rocky islets, 40 km west of Heard Island (Encyclopaedia Britannica 2006).Heard Island has approximately 362.5 km 2 of area and the McDonald Island, 2.6 km 2.The site includes the adjacent offshore rocks and shoals and all territorial waters to a distance of 12 nautical

Why are Heard Island and McDonald Islands isolated?

However, the site’s isolation assists in reducing anthropogenic impacts upon the site’s values. Heard Island and McDonald Islands are located in the Southern Ocean, approximately 1,700 km from the Antarctic continent and 4,100 km south-west of Perth.

Is there a threat to Heard Island and the McDonald Islands?

Ongoing and accelerating climate change poses an increasing risk of fundamental alterations in biodiversity. Geological processes (primarily volcanism and glacial retreat) continue undisturbed. The overall assessment is that there is a low threat to the World Heritage values of Heard Island and the McDonald Islands if visitation remains low.

Where are Heard Island and McDonald Islands located?

The islands are a territory (Territory of Heard Island and McDonald Islands) of Australia administered from Hobart by the Australian Antarctic Division of the Australian Department of Climate Change, Energy, the Environment and Water.

How big is Heard Island & McDonald Islands?

The group's overall land area is 372 km 2 (144 sq mi) and it has 101.9 km (63 mi) of coastline. Discovered in the mid-19th century, the islands lie on the Kerguelen Plateau in the Indian Ocean and have been an Australian territory since 1947. Heard Island and McDonald Islands contain Australia's only two active volcanoes.

What is a hotspot under Heard Island & McDonald Islands?

A hotspot under Heard Island and the McDonald Islands is responsible for the volcanic activity in the region. (ABC: Kate Doyle) Volcanoes are more common at the boundaries of tectonic plates, where plates split or collide and magma escapes. That type of volcanism is well understood and proven but hotspots are not.
